My number one tip I give to all my clients is to repurpose your floral arrangements. Take the flowers you have in your ceremony space and use them in your reception space. If you have a flower arch at the altar, after the ceremony take it and use it for the entrance to your reception space, or use it as a photo opt for your guests. Use the floral arrangements that line your ceremony aisle as eye-catching decorations at the base of your head table. Using your florals in both spaces adds a continuous, cohesive, and elegant flow to the day, and allows you and your guests to admire them all day.


Another tip I suggest is using the bridal bouquets as décor on the head table. Just like reusing the ceremony florals in the reception space, this tip allows the stunning handheld arrangements to serve a purpose after the I Dos. They add a beautiful touch to the table, whether in vases or just delicately laying on it, while also taking them off the bridal party’s hands (no pun intended). This ensures your bridal party is free to enjoy the evening without stressing about misplacing the bouquets.

To ensure these transitions from the ceremony to the reception are seamless and stress-free, I highly recommend that you consult with your florist or your wedding planner about having them handle the moving of arrangements. This professional touch ensures your bridal party won’t have to worry about this step and instead they can relax and enjoy every moment of your special day. (P.S. One last tip I have is to preserve your bridal bouquet. Your wedding day tends to pass quickly, but the beauty of your bouquet doesn’t have to! Preserving your bridal floral arrangement allows you to cherish its beauty forever and keep a tangible reminder of your special day. From pressing and framing it, to using resin art and creating a feature piece, there are numerous gorgeous ways to keep your flowers forever.
